removin stereo and amp power hookup
I really would like to install an amp and my speakers..but everyone on the TA is soo hard to get to.. like the stereo and cant seem to pull the head unit out all the way so i can plug my RCA cable in.. i dont want to like jerk it out and have every wire being stripped and disconnected. anyone?? is it that hard to pull the sucker out?? And also how the world do you run the power cable to the battery, ive found no grommel holes to run the cable through the firewall. Any ideas and info is much appreciated!!

Re: removin stereo and amp power hookup
the hole is on the passenger side, and it blocked off with a rubbery black seel. Its located in the top right corner use a flashlight and you should see it. you just need to puncture the hole and then jam the power cable through there and look for it under the hood. Also buy a head unit. I tried the whole stock stereo setup and got it to work. But it sounds so much worse because you cannot use RCA's with it. I could tell you how to do it for the stock HU but its not worth it.

Re: Re: removin stereo and amp power hookup
Quote:
Power wire...you will have to remove the car's PCM to get easier access to the rubber seal. just push the wire through. You will have to take the kick panel off on the passenger side as well as the glove box to run the wire through all the way back to the back then. That's the hardest part of the amp install. As far as your stereo, you can not use RCAs w/the stocker. Your amp has to have high level inputs or get an adaptor kit if you do not get an aftermarket stereo.
